I was looking for some clarification on the restrictions placed on multi-boxing.

Here is an excerpt from the Terms of Use on the subject:

"How about multi-boxing and bots?
You're not allowed to use any form of program to control multiple characters at once. You are, however, allowed to be logged on, say, two characters. The only thing we allow multiple characters for, is professions and banking, this means you cannot /follow level 2 characters at once. This will result in a ban of one of the two, and if repeated, both. It is also not a problem if you are, for instance, three family members in the same house, playing at the same time. Each multi-box case will be judged individually, so don't worry if you're not doing anything wrong. What you can't do, is PvP with multiple characters, Dungeon with multiple characters, Raid with multiple characters, etc.

If you are two people playing two characters - no problem. If you are 5 people playing 5 characters - no problem.
Once a player get caught, GM shall ask him which account he want to keep, all others accounts shall receive a permanent closure."

The part pertaining to botting needs no clarification.

An example of what is clearly forbidden:

Playing two characters on one computer, in one zone, and having one character on follow while you play the other. This includes world activity, BGs, dungeons, and raids.

However it is unclear on some things:

Can I play my Mage and do Battlegrounds, then between queues tab to my Shaman and do quests?

Can I bring my two characters together in a major city and make food, water, do enchants, create portals, etc for the other character?

Say I am playing my Mage and Shaman at the same time, one is sitting in a city by the auction house while I do quests with my friend on the other. I decide to craft some stuff to sell with my Mage in the main city, so I put my friend on follow with my Shaman while I craft some items/post them with Mage. Is this forbidden?

It would be great if someone with authority could comment and clarify this for me. It would be nice to know now rather than find out by getting banned.

There's a very clear line seperating multiboxing and simultaneously follow leveling 2 characters from /following an alt. This line obviously isn't clear to the players or the GMs, since there are CONSTANT ban appeals on the matter.

As stated in the TOU, it's not allowed to multibox to level 2 characters simultaneously. I.e the characters are not allowed to be around the same level and partied up so they both receive xp and quest completion. However, if the other character is much higher or lower level, it wouldn't receive xp or quest completion and it wouldn't be leveled up simultaneously. Still... both cases = instaban, even if it's completely different from what's unambiguously stated in the TOU.
